Come Take a Walk with Me

March 1, 2009 | Journal Article

The "go-along" interview method is an opportunity for health researchers to learn more about place by going with individuals on excursions within the local-area context. The "go-along" interview method can be used with other research methods and has a number of advantages and limitations.

Disparities in Urban Neighborhood Conditions

January 1, 2009 | Journal Article

Low-income urban neighborhoods are less conducive to walking than other neighborhoods, even if they have comparable population densities, street layouts, and mixed-land use, according to this study of census data and direct observation of neighborhoods in New York City.
